Contents:
General principles of argumentation -- Legal reasoning -- Briefing -- Oral argument.
Summary: Presents the basics of writing legal briefs and giving oral arguments, with discussions on the essentials of building a case through legal reasoning and the key elements of persuasive and successful oral pleading in the courtroom.
